When it comes to roofing options, flat roofs often get a bad reputation. Many homeowners shy away from this architectural style, believing in numerous misconceptions that have been circulating for years. Myth 1: Flat Roofs Always Leak

A common and enduring misconception is that flat roofs are naturally more likely to leak. While it's true that older flat roof technologies were less effective, modern roofing techniques have revolutionized flat roof design. Today's flat roofs use advanced waterproofing membranes, sophisticated drainage systems, and seamless installation methods that significantly reduce the risk of water infiltration.

Myth 2: Flat Roofs Have No Drainage

Despite the common misconception, flat roofs are not perfectly level. They have a slight pitch (typically 1/4 inch per foot) that allows water to drain effectively. Professional roofing companies design these roofs with strategic slope and multiple drainage points to ensure water moves away from the structure efficiently.

Myth 3: Flat Roofs Are Only Suitable for Commercial Buildings

This myth couldn't be further from the truth. Modern residential architecture increasingly incorporates flat roofs for their sleek design, additional usable space, and energy efficiency. Homeowners are discovering the versatility of flat roofs, using them for rooftop gardens, solar panel installations, and outdoor living spaces.

Myth 4: Flat Roofs Have a Short Lifespan

When installed and maintained correctly, flat roofs can be just as durable as traditional pitched roofs. High-quality materials like EPDM, TPO, and modified bitumen can provide 20-30 years of reliable protection when professionally installed and regularly maintained.

Myth 5: Flat Roofs Are More Expensive

While initial installation might seem costlier, flat roofs can be more economical in the long run. They require fewer materials, are easier to install, and provide additional usable space that can increase your property's value. The energy efficiency of modern flat roof technologies can also lead to significant savings on heating and cooling costs.

Maintenance Considerations

Flat roofs, like all roofing systems, need regular maintenance. Annual inspections by a professional roofing company can help identify and address potential issues before they become major problems. This includes checking for membrane integrity, clearing drainage points, and ensuring proper sealing.

Material Advancements

Today’s flat roofing materials have advanced significantly. Innovations like reflective coatings, improved waterproofing technologies, and more durable membranes have addressed many of the historical concerns about flat roof performance.

Energy Efficiency Benefits

Flat roofs offer excellent opportunities for energy-efficient upgrades. They provide ideal surfaces for solar panel installations, green roofing systems, and cool roof technologies that reflect sunlight and reduce heat absorption.
